How to Calculate the Cost per Bag of French Fries?

To determine the cost per bag of French fries, you need to consider several factors, including the cost of potatoes, oil, packaging, and the number of servings you can produce. The formula to calculate the cost per bag is as follows:

  1. Calculate the Total Cost:

    The total cost is the sum of the costs of potatoes, oil, and packaging. The formula is:

    §§ \text{Total Cost} = (\text{Potato Cost per kg} \times \text{Potato Amount}) + (\text{Oil Cost per liter} \times \text{Oil Amount}) + (\text{Packaging Cost per unit} \times \text{Number of Servings}) §§

    where:

    • Potato Cost per kg: The cost of potatoes per kilogram.
    • Potato Amount: The total amount of potatoes used in kilograms.
    • Oil Cost per liter: The cost of oil per liter.
    • Oil Amount: The total amount of oil used in liters.
    • Packaging Cost per unit: The cost of packaging for each serving.
    • Number of Servings: The total number of servings produced.
  2. Calculate the Cost per Bag:

    Once you have the total cost, you can find the cost per bag using the formula:

    §§ \text{Cost per Bag} = \frac{\text{Total Cost}}{\text{Total Output}} §§

    where:

    • Total Output: The total number of servings produced from the amount of potatoes used, calculated as:

    §§ \text{Total Output} = \text{Potato Amount} \times \text{Output per kg} §§

    • Output per kg: The number of servings produced from one kilogram of potatoes.

Example Calculation

Let’s say you have the following values:

  • Potato Cost per kg: $2
  • Potato Amount: 5 kg
  • Oil Cost per liter: $1.5
  • Oil Amount: 2 liters
  • Packaging Cost per unit: $0.5
  • Number of Servings: 10
  • Output per kg: 5 servings

Step 1: Calculate Total Cost

  • Total Potato Cost: $2 * 5 kg = $10
  • Total Oil Cost: $1.5 * 2 liters = $3
  • Total Packaging Cost: $0.5 * 10 servings = $5

Total Cost = $10 + $3 + $5 = $18

Step 2: Calculate Total Output

Total Output = 5 kg * 5 servings/kg = 25 servings

Step 3: Calculate Cost per Bag

Cost per Bag = Total Cost / Total Output = $18 / 25 = $0.72

When to Use the Cost per Bag of French Fries Calculator?

  1. Cost Analysis: Determine the overall cost of producing French fries for budgeting and pricing strategies.

    • Example: A restaurant owner can use this calculator to set the price of French fries on the menu.
  2. Ingredient Costing: Evaluate the impact of ingredient price changes on the overall cost of production.

    • Example: Assessing how a rise in potato prices affects the cost per serving.
  3. Menu Planning: Help in planning menu items based on cost efficiency.

    • Example: Deciding whether to include French fries as a side dish based on production costs.
  4. Business Operations: Optimize purchasing decisions for ingredients based on cost calculations.

    • Example: A food truck owner can calculate costs to ensure profitability.

Definitions of Key Terms

  • Potato Cost per kg: The price you pay for one kilogram of potatoes.
  • Oil Cost per liter: The price you pay for one liter of cooking oil.
  • Packaging Cost per unit: The cost associated with packaging each serving of fries.
  • Output per kg: The number of servings that can be produced from one kilogram of potatoes.
